Shiroli MIDC, Gokul Shirgaon and Kagal hold a foundry cluster that has worked for decades, casting grey and SG iron parts for tractors, pumps, vehicles and machines. Each heat has a charge mix, a spectro report and a set of castings that carry its quality.

The rest of Kolhapur trades jaggery at the Shahu Market Yard, sells Kolhapuri chappals and saaj jewellery, and runs on sugar and dairy co-operatives across the district. Rajarampuri and Mahadwar Road hold the city’s shops, clinics and professional firms.

Foundry owners in Kolhapur are often second or third generation, and they buy through the foundry association and what their peers run. They want software their melting supervisor will actually fill, not one the office fills later.

Kolhapur is close to the Karnataka border, so some offices work in Marathi and Kannada and many owners do business with Belagavi. Above all, they want a vendor who will still answer the phone after the sale.

We cannot tell which heat a rejected casting came from

Castings leave with a heat number stamped, but the charge mix and spectro result are in a separate book. Linking heat, pattern and customer lot in one record makes the rejection traceable.

Patterns go missing at vendors and the register is out of date

Customer-owned patterns move between the foundry, pattern shop and machinist. A pattern register with location and last-used date shows where each one is.

Can furnace and spectrometer readings go straight into the software?

Often, yes. Many spectrometers export a file or connect over the network, and we read those into the heat record. For older machines, the operator enters readings on a tablet next to the furnace.
